Area of a square = x² ( x is the length of a side)
Area = 36cm² = x² = 6²
length of one side of the square in the scale drawing = 6cm
since the diagram is scaled to 1cm : 3ft
the actual length = 6 × 3 ft = 18ft
the actual area = x² = 18² = 324 ft²
the ratio of the area in the drawing to the
actual area is
36 cm² : 324 ft²
to get the simplest ratio we divide both sides by 36 ( as 36 is the factor they both share in common)
the simplest ratio of the area in the drawing to the
actual area is
1 : 9
